Finding our location
We are located at 1608 Highway 59 in Jefferson, TX
We are right on Highway 59 on the south side of Jefferson. Our church is easy to find if you can find Jefferson. Sometimes our address does not work in a GPS, so be careful about that.

What's here for my kids?
Starting with the nurseries, there is something special for every age child from birth through college! At every service there are safe, clean nurseries for children three years old and under. For children four years old through sixth grade there are fun, friendly, and Bible-centered classes on Sunday mornings. For student's seventh grade through twelfth grade, there are fun and exciting Bible Classes at their level.
What's the Sunday morning schedule?
All the Bible Classes begin at 10:00am. Plan to arrive a few minutes early so that we can help direct your family to the correct nurseries or groups. This will also give you some time to meet the teachers of your family's classes. The Sunday morning worship service starts at 11:00am.
What's on the schedule for adults, and what should I expect?
The best way to get to know people at Heritage Baptist Church is to visit our Adult Bible Class where you will get practical, relevant Bible teaching. Most adults then will then attend the worship service, where they will enjoy Godly music and uplifting services. The music is always followed by a clear, helpful, and challenging Bible message from Pastor Buckner. This service around one hour in length.
How should I dress?
There is not a dress code at Heritage Baptist Church for members or guests. Our ministry leaders and many of our church family dress in more traditional “Sunday” dress; however, our main goal is that you would feel welcome and comfortable on your visit here! Are there services at other times?
Yes. We have a Sunday evening service (completely different from Sunday morning) that begins at 6:00pm. Again, in this service you'll enjoy the special music as well as a challenging and helpful message from Pastor Buckner. We also meet on Wednesday evenings at 7:00 pm for a mid-week Bible study in our fellowship hall. If you can't be our guest on Sunday morning, we hope you'll visit with us during another service time.
